Action item from the Vantrell session-token incident (week of the Corbyn Hall outage). Tokens refreshed within the clock-skew window were rejected because the grace period was shorter than our proxy's retry interval, logging users out mid-session. Owner: platform auth team. We are widening the grace window, aligning retry backoff with token TTL, and adding a canary alert on refresh failure rate above two percent. Please review before Thursday's sync. The revised timing constants we propose to ship are listed below.

limits module of yahaf-fadup:
QUOTAS = {
    "ulawyn": 2,
    "wenwyn": 5,
    "holwyn": 2,
    "oliix": 1,
}

Our client retries resolution three times with jittered backoff before falling back to the cached address, which is refreshed every 300 seconds. Reviewers should note that all retries occur over the encrypted channel and no credentials are transmitted during resolution itself. For local verification against the staging resolver, the service authenticates with the credential shown directly below this paragraph.

gateway credential: kto11_pTkcHgLwuNE

Internal memo — driver coordination, Fenwick Archive run. Four canisters of nitrate-era film reels are being transferred from the Oldcroft depot to the Fenwick Moving Image Archive on Monday. The canisters are fragile and temperature-sensitive: keep them upright, out of direct sun, and do not stack anything on top. Allow extra time at the archive loading bay, as access is narrow. The confidential courier hand-over instruction appears below.

courier memo of yawep-yafog: the pramir ulaix courier leaves the ulavan aldix frair zorok oliiel joreth rusdor fenvan ledger at gate 1305 under passcode 514738

Subject: Blue-green deploys for the billing worker

Hi Priya,

Welcome to the on-call rotation. The Ledgerline billing worker ships via blue-green deploys: we stand up the green pool, drain invoices from blue, then flip routing once the queue depth hits zero. Never flip mid-batch — partial charges are painful to reconcile. Rollback is just flipping back, but note the queue offsets first. The full cutover checklist lives on our internal wiki page.

operations page: https://jenkins.zemvarcloud.local/job/merge_requests/repo/build/73930b4b30f0a8ed